You do not need a complex portfolio of dozens of mutual funds or individual stocks to retire early. The Bogleheads-style Three-Fund Portfolio is one of the most popular setups for passive investors, offering extreme diversification, low fees, and effortless maintenance.
The portfolio uses three asset classes: a Total Domestic Stock Market Index Fund, a Total International Stock Market Index Fund, and a Total Bond Market Index Fund. Adjusting the allocation percentages allows you to tailor the risk and return characteristics to your specific retirement timeline.
This simplicity prevents emotional trading errors and reduces management costs. As you approach early retirement, shift the ratio slightly toward bonds to secure your short-term cash needs without having to dismantle your compound interest engine.
